After teasing the audience with the Lesnar/Strowman showdown and the prospect of a good old fashioned hossfight, with the crowd seemingly getting behind him in the confrontation, Braun instead chose to walk away from the former UFC heavyweight champion.

His backing down caused the fans to erupt in a chant of "bullsh*t", but the seeds have been planted for what could be an intriguing program in the future between WWE's two most intimidating figures.

There were other chants throughout the night, such as the singing of various themes, but these were the ones that truly stood out, Outside of the profanity Roman was heckled with in the opening segment and the disrespect of the beach ball shenanigans during Neville's match, this was one of the calmer, more well-behaved post-Mania crowds we've had in a while.

They allowed the show to unfold and enhanced the program rather than trying to hijack it.

And the best part of all? There wasn't one single "CM Punk" chant.

Thank you, Orlando *clap, clap, clapclapclap*
